This significant Power consumption of streetlights might be attributed to many factors. These include things like the usage of inefficient significant-intensity discharge (HID) lamps rather than more recent technology of LED lamps, unmetered ability consumption and electric power leaks in which municipalities are billed a set Vitality payment, and inefficient light Manage that retains lamps totally on even though there's no desire for light. Thus, the need for smart and sustainable management of the source is evident.

This might contain separating shifting objects like cars or pedestrians in the static history. Function Extraction follows, the place specific attributes within the segmented objects are gathered. These characteristics can range between basic geometric properties like dimension or shape, to far more complex visual features, like texture or coloration. Lastly, in the Decision Creating stage, the program utilizes the extracted characteristics to help make a dedication or prediction. This may possibly entail classifying an item, estimating pace, or pinpointing the extent of activity inside a scene. Subsequent this pipeline, the extracted Street Light Controller data can be used to control the brightness level of the SLs, amongst other programs.
